Output 34afa2eae4b5f02cd37187ca0385d24fdaf8af4e7adf157f21fbe7e13e6f5614:0

value
854892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e038844701098bb533c7e99fc543f41870b08e95 OP_EQUAL
address
3N8azN37FoYMpTtf1cj6VyukPWBHUDV8QV
transaction
34afa2eae4b5f02cd37187ca0385d24fdaf8af4e7adf157f21fbe7e13e6f5614
spent
true